The Newton, Massachusetts Animal Response Team (NMART) is a network of organizations and individuals responsible for coordinating the public, private and human resources needed for the rescue, recovery, sheltering, and care of animals during federal, state and local emergencies and the operation of Newton’s animal emergency facilities.
NMART is a volunteer organization under the leadership and guidance of the Newton Police Department. During a disaster situation involving the city of Newton, the Newton Police Department will activate the NMART team and open the animal emergency shelters to respond to the needs of the animal population in Newton. The NMART team utilizes the principles of the Incident Command System (ICS) and the National Incident Management System (NIMS).
